Sat 769179098536731

decimal
153835.4098536731
degree
0°153835′619″4098536731‴
percentile
36.62757616108706%
name
ikbusytdypq
cycle
0
epoch
0
period
76
block
153835
offset
4098536731
timestamp
rarity
common